The 22-year-old prop, who featured for Edinburgh in the recent back-up match at Lasswade, pulled out Sonians name to face Biggar while Heriot's captain Marc Teague, who also represented Edinburgh against Glasgow last week, saw his club draw either Cartha Queens Park or Ayr or Currie. Scottish Hydro Electric Cup quarter-final draw (ties to be played on Saturday, April 5). Haddington v Jed-Forest; Watsonians v Biggar; Cartha Queens Park or Ayr or Currie v Heriot's; Hawick v Melrose.
